Great Marketing Won’t Save A Destroyed Business Rep

  • by Viking Wanderer

When you’re marketing your company, you do have to consider the issues that can impact your business brand and the reputation of your company. Any marketing expert will tell you that issues here will result in significantly lower sales and ultimate could cause customers to choose your competition instead. As such, business owners need to be aware of what can impact brand reputation and how to fix problems if and when they develop.

 

Trouble With Outsourcing

You might find that your brand is impacted by an issue with an outsourcing service that you have chosen to use. It is crucial that when you use an outsourcing service, you can trust the quality of the service that they provide. If you can’t then remember, customers won’t know you’re outsourcing. So, any issue here will reflect directly on your company, rather than the one that you might be using.

The best way to vet an outsourcing service is to look for buzz as well as opinions about the company online. Make sure that previous customers and clients were happy with their service and that they themselves have a solid reputation.

 

Marketing Scandals

It’s true to say that businesses can find themselves in hot water due to errors in judgement with marketing campaigns. As an example. H&M recently came under fire for using a young black boy to model a hoodie with the caption ‘the coolest monkey in the jungle.’ Be aware that your interpretation of this campaign matters very little. A significant portion of the buying public were offended, leading to an apology from the company. Leading from this, an apology is perhaps the best way to deal with a marketing scandal like this, and it’s worth remembering an important phrase. The customer is always right.

 

Liability Of Legal Issues

You also need to be careful that your business doesn’t become embroiled in a legal matter. Harassment is always on people’s mind right now, and any whiff that your business has issues in this area will almost certainly lead to a backlash from customers and clients abandoning your business. Handling this issue, you need to make sure you are getting legal advice regularly using outsourced HR services of a full legal team if you’re running a larger company. You must be able to access the advice necessary and ensure that you stay on the right side of the legal line.

 

Trouble With Customer Support

Of course, one of the most common problems with a business brand is that customers feel that they are not treated the right way. If customers have issues with your company, they should have a way to address the problems and make sure that they are able to resolve it quickly. Outsourcing services do exist for customer service so if you can’t squeeze a full team of staff into your business budget, this might be the best option.

As you can see, there are a number of issues that can impact your business brand. But, if you take the right steps, you can protect your business brand and reputation.
